1 The Kenyan Sectin f the Internatinal Cmmissin f Jurists Outline f Presentatin and Recmmendatins t the TJRC Issue 1: Capital punishment in Kenya is a critical access t justice issue. Kenya is increasingly islated as a retentinist natin: In all, 13 African cuntries have ablished the death penalty. These include, in West Africa, Guinea Bissau, Ivry Cast, Senegal and Tg. In suthern Africa Angla, Namibia and Suth Africa have ablished the penalty. The east and central African cuntries that have ablished the penalty are Rwanda, Burundi, Djibuti, Seychelles, and Mauritius. Nrth Africa has the largest number f retentinist states as nne f the cuntries in this regin has ablished the death penalty. If Rwanda, which faced gencide n a massive scale, can ablish the death penalty, n cuntry shuld cnsider that it has faced crimes fr which the death penalty is a necessary and inescapable respnse. Use f the death penalty is incnsistent with Kenya s ratificatin f internatinal human rights instruments such as the UDHR, ICCPR, Cnventin against Trture and adptin and incrpratin f the Rme Statute t mentin but a few Fr example, currently, Kenya faces a ridiculus paradx while thse facing trial at the ICC fr the mst serius internatinal crimes are nt eligible fr the death penalty, a pr Kenyan wh steals sme bread and des s while carrying a weapn culd be sentenced t death; this is a manifestly unfair regime. Capital defendants are nt prvided with sufficient access t legal cunsel, making their sentences a systematic vilatin f human rights The recent Macharia case cnfirmed that capital defendants have a right t effective cunsel under the new Cnstitutin; hwever this fundamental principle is nt being implemented. In the absence f a legal aid scheme in the cuntry, capital defendants right t cunsel is regularly being breached. Judicial rulings n capital cases have been arbitrary and incnsistent, making applicatin f the death penalty in Kenya a grss vilatin f human rights Fr example, at a recent cnference in Rwanda, a Kenyan judge, representing the Kenyan delegatin, infrmed the cnference that a Curt f Appeal case had remved the mandatry requirement f the Death Penalty as a sentence fr certain crimes. 1

2 Hwever, just the previus day, a High Curt Judge had gne against this Curt f Appeal decisin and had impsed a mandatry death sentence, bserving that Curts were under a legal bligatin t impse it, ging s far as t challenge the President s decisin t cmmute previus death sentences t life imprisnment, saying, the President shuld sign death warrants passed by the Curt, as failure t d s is t fail in his cnstitutinal duty. Under internatinal law, the death penalty is t be impsed nly fr the mst serius crimes and can never be applied in an arbitrary manner. Unfrtunately, that is exactly what is happening in Kenya given the cnfused state f Kenyan judicial decisin-making. Recmmendatin: The TJRC shuld recmmend that the death penalty be ablished in Kenya. Ablitin f the death is the nly way t ensure that the penalty is nt used fr purpses f plitical repressin. Fr instance, Suth Africa s judiciary utlawed the death penalty in the famus Makwanyane case, bserving that this sentence had been a majr tl f repressin during apartheid, and that there was n justificatin fr such a sentence in a free Suth Africa. Namibia, which had had a similarly abusive use f the death sentence, decided at independence nt t retain the penalty in its law bks. The danger f deplying the death penalty t achieve plitical repressin is still present in independent African cuntries, except that because f the changed racial cntext, it appears less as a plitical tl. T make this pint, the example f Kenya was prvided: the lngstanding mratrium against the death penalty was temprarily lifted in 1987, t allw the gvernment t execute thse cnvicted fr invlvement in the abrtive attempt t verthrw the gvernment in The mratrium then resumed and has held until nw. The danger is that despite the current mratrium, until the practiced is abandned in law, the penalty can be arbitrarily applied fr plitical reasns. The pressure generated by plitical trials can easily lead t a lifting f the mratrium, even if temprarily. Fr all the reasns, discussed abve, ICJ Kenya firmly believes that the death penalty shuld be ablished. Issue 2: The relatinship between the judiciary and the brader fight against crruptin in Kenya has been a majr prblem. The judiciary has traditinally been ne f the weakest links in that its jurisprudence n crruptin has been significantly flawed, resulting in impunity. In the wrst incidents, the Judiciary has been cmplicit and an active participant in crruptin, fr instance in 2005, when judges rganized tw lawyers t file a suit t ppse the cnstitutinal review prcess, which at the time had threatened the vested interests f the judges. In essence, the judges judged in their wn cause, in a suit that had been prcured thrugh deceit. Gatekeeping is a term that the legal cmmunity in Kenya uses t describe arrangements in which the Judiciary ensures that special interests are prtected when the Judiciary is called upn 2

3 t adjudicate disputes. Gatekeeping is an ld prblem in the Kenyan judiciary. During the neparty era, which was characterized by attempts t challenge the establishment using the curts f law, the Judiciary rganized itself t walk the tight rpe f supprting the gvernment f the day as best as it culd, n the ne hand, and maintaining a façade f impartiality, n the ther. One f the ways in which gatekeeping was delivered at that time was thrugh the cntrl f case allcatin in the curts. As part f this scheme, certain safe judges were assigned t any cases that sught t challenge the gvernment f the day. As a result f this many cases were wrngfully decided, including ne where the Bill f Rights under the Cnstitutin was fund t be unenfrceable! I will highlight three majr examples where the gatekeeping functin has been exercised: Saitti Case Gerge Saitti, then the Vice President and Minister f Finance, was highly implicated by the cmmissin f inquiry int the Gldenberg scandal. He decided t sue the Cmmissin fr implicating him. Despite the fact that the Cmmissin was n lnger in existence at the time, as it had expired, the judge hearing the case allwed the matter t be filed n the nn-existent secretariat f the Cmmissin. Then, in its judgment, the curt held that nt nly were there factual errrs in the Gldenberg Reprt, but it als suggested hw the reprt shuld be rewrded, and, in effect, abslved Saitti f any liability. This in turn led t several prceedings by ther implicated fficials, seeking t be similarly abslved. In this case, the Curt acted as a gatekeeper, by hearing an appeal n the findings f the Gldenberg inquiry, a pwer it des nt have Allwing the matter t prceed withut giving reasnable pprtunity fr participatin by the authrs f the reprt, which had been disslved The prsecutin functin f the gvernment was nt clistered by the findings f the inquiry whether r nt these were factually crrect as the gvernment was nt bliged t rely n the cntents f the reprt in munting a prsecutin. Curts have a cnstitutinal duty t review fr legality, the decisins f the ther arms f gvernment. Illegality in relatin t the Gldenberg affair culd nt have been cured by a mere reslutin f Parliament Eric Ktut Case Als stemming frm the Gldenberg Scandal, Eric Ktut, and the Gvernr f the Central Bank was facing a criminal case, but the case has nt prceeded n tw grunds, that the Gldenberg reprt cntained factual errrs, and that there had been inrdinate delay in bringing charges against him. There were several irregularities with this case: Ktut sught and successfully managed t impugn the cntents f a reprt whse authrs were nt in any serius way heard in Curt. The High Curt allwed Ktut s case t be brught against the Attrney General. The Attrney 3

4 General was tasked with defending a reprt he did nt write, n behalf f an entity that n lnger existed. Secndly, even if the reprt f the Cmmissin cntained factual errrs, as the curt fund it did, it is difficult t accept its decisin n the effect f thse errrs. Accrding t the curt, the errrs invalidated a trial f Ktut by a curt f law. Why wuld this be the case, if it is accepted that a curt f law is under duty t evaluate all the evidence brught befre it afresh and is nt bund by the cntents f the reprt? Why wuld the fact that the reprt had errrs nt be Ktut s defence t a charge against him in a criminal curt? If a trial is brught that is based n errneus infrmatin, an accused will have pprtunity t pint this ut during the trial and will, if the curt accepts his reasning, be entitled t an acquittal. But, it is nt clear hw errrs can invalidate a trial, and there was n legal basis fr the curt t alter the findings f the Cmmissin f Inquiry n Ktut, even if they were in errr. Thirdly, the curt fund that there had been delay in the cmmencement f prceedings against Ktut, in breach f the cnstitutinal prvisins which grant a right t a fair trial within reasnable time. But this is surely incrrect. The cnstitutinal prvisins fr the right t a fair trial d nt prhibit delay in bringing criminal charges against a persn. What the prvisins prhibit is delay in the hearing f a criminal case nce the charges have been brught against a persn. As it is pssible fr a crime t be detected fr the first time lng after it was cmmitted, it wuld nt be reasnable fr the law t prvide a time limit, by reference t when the alleged ffence was cmmitted, within which a persn can be charged in curt. The Curt misapplied the Cnstitutin, and misrepresented previus cases talking abut this subject, t rule in Ktut s favur Finally, the Curt, withut an applicatin n the matter r any cited evidence, fund that the amunt f publicity that the case against Ktut had received, bth in Kenya and internatinally, made it difficult t cnduct a fair trial f the case. It will remain a mystery why the curt decided that the wide publicity n the case was prejudicial t a fair trial. If these decisins cntinue t stand, they will frm the basis fr further, similar cases t fail. Nedmar Case this case is part f the Angl Leasing scandal, where the gvernment awarded cntracts wrth $ 400 millin and a further Eurs 309 millin t 18 shadwy cmpanies. Nedmar was ne f the cmpanies invlved in these cntracts, which were bund by strict secrecy rules. The Kenya Anti-Crruptin Cmmissin attempted t investigate these transactins, but was blcked by the Curt, which granted rders the Nedmar, ex parte, r withut KACC being represented in curt, n the basis that an investigatin wuld prejudice the secrecy prvisins f the cntract. The Curt made this determinatin despite the fact that a gvernment fficial had filed a swrn 4

5 dcument waiving the secrecy prvisins, and in the face f the claim that the cntract may have been fraudulent. Kadhi Curts Case In this case, a judge sught t ban Kadhi curts. This judgment seems t attempt t utlaw ne f the riginal articles f the Cnstitutin, which the Curts cannt d. And, by including the Cnstitutin f Kenya Review Cmmissin as a party, the Curt vilated the rule that curts shuld nt act in vain by entertaining litigatin with an unenfrceable utcme. The cncern with cases like these, is that certain members f the Judiciary have in the past taken deliberate steps impede access t justice and as a result frmed the cnstitutinal basis fr judicial vetting prcess. Recmmendatin: The TJRC shuld declare its supprt fr the nging judicial refrm prjects, and especially the vetting f judges and magistrates. The TJRC shuld include in its recmmendatins additinal mechanisms t prmte an independent, impartial, and crruptin-free Judiciary. Issue 3: Related t issue 2, there have been miscarriages f justice thrughut the TJRC s mandated time perid as a result f the failure f the judicial system t fairly and effectively carry ut its fundamental functin. This has impacted a wide array f cases including: Wrngfully decided Criminal cases, including death penalty cases Wrngfully decided civil suits that have resulted in manifest injustice Wrngfully decided anti-crruptin cases Wrngfully decided land claims cases These wrngfully decided cases have tw majr repercussins: First, the parties in a wrngfully decided case suffer direct injustice, whether thrugh wrngful cnvictins, imprper sentencing, damage awards in civil cases that are disprprtinate t the harms suffered, and, especially with regards t land claims, nging and perpetual cnflict ver individual and grup rights. Secnd, in a cmmn law system Judicial Decisins create new law, by virtue f the fact that they are precedent setting. Wrngfully decided, ften cntradictry decisins mean that a large prtin f Kenyan Law is cnfusing, unclear, unpredictable and unenfrceable. 5

6 Recmmendatin: The TJRC shuld recmmend that the judiciary establish a credible mechanism f case review t ensure that past injustices are remedied. Criminal cases that resulted in deprivatin f liberty shuld be priritized, especially where the death penalty r life imprisnment has been invlved. In additin, an independent bdy shuld be frmed t specifically review cases and decisins related t past instances f injustice where individuals were prsecuted and punished fr plitical and/r nnlegal reasns. Resurces and rganizatin shuld be recmmended fr n-ging judicial training and sensitizatin n Cmmn Law principles, rules and standards f Judicial Cnduct. Issue 4: Kenya s judicial system suffers frm fundamental structural, prcess, and capacity issues that hamper access t justice and undermine cnfidence in the Judiciary. These prblems include: prcess issues delays backlg csts persnnel issues case management judicial training curt infrastructure and technlgy crruptin within the judiciary and judicial administratin crruptin within the prcurement prcess that supprts judicial functins Recmmendatins: The TJRC shuld publicly declare its supprt fr nging judicial refrm effrts and specifically recmmend that the Judiciary Transfrmative Framewrk shuld be fast structured and pririty areas such as thse prpsed t deal with case backlgs and an increase in judicial persnnel shuld be urgently priritized. In rder t curb the rampant crruptin in the Judiciary, the TJRC shuld recmmend that the Vetting prcess shuld be extended t include judicial supprts staff as they are the main drivers f crruptin within the judicial system. Issue 5: Prvisin f legal assistance t the pr is a majr access t justice issue. There currently is n natinal legal aid prgram in Kenya. As such, lw-incme individuals are dependent n a netwrk f ver-stretched NGO and cmmunity-based prgrams that cannt service the demand. As a result, many wh need justice are turned away and are unable t access the curts. ICJ K has wrked cnsistently ver the years t imprve access t legal services thrugh training and establishing paralegal netwrks and thrugh wrking with the Ministry f Justice t develp legal aid legislatin. Hwever, the majr challenges t any legal aid scheme are adequate funding and equitable allcatin f resurces. 6

7 Recmmendatin: The TJRC shuld reiterate the gvernment s respnsibility t pass legislatin establishing and fully funding a legal assistance regime fr thse wh cannt affrd legal services it shuld highlight that the legal aid scheme must equitably prvide services t particularly vulnerable grups and in traditinally marginalized areas. Issue 6: The structure f the DPP s ffice is prblematic in that it des nt allw fr transparent and accuntable prsecutrial decisin-making. In the first instance, the appintment prcess f the Directr f Public Prsecutin was heavily criticized fr a lack f transparency and resulted in plitical plarizatin. The perceived failure in the interview prcess was attributed t a lack f an pen and transparent selectin and appintment prcess such that there is still t date a pending curt case n this. Currently, the ffice f the Directr f Public Prsecutins faces challenges in its internal structures and has huge peratinal weaknesses. The present staff was inherited frm the State Law Office and the numbers f recmmended and authrized psts are yet t be filled r the institutin adequately funded. There are new areas f emerging crime that require sund technical cmpetence and likely t be a challenge t the prsecutin service. Appeals frm the prsecutin service take t lng t finalize and there is limited undertaking f pre trials with witnesses There is a weak crdinatin between the Plice Prsecutrs and State Cunsels Recmmendatin: The TJRC shuld recmmend that all public ffice appintment prcesses that require a selectin prcess shuld be cnducted in an pen, transparent and credible set criterin. Any appintment that fails t adhere t the established minimum standards shuld be nullified. It shuld recmmend that the Office f the Directr f Public Prsecutins shuld be adequately funded t enable it functin ptimally. Furthermre, the TJRC shuld recmmend an increase in f persnnel as well as strengthening f the Capacities f the staff at the Office f the Directr f Public Prsecutins t enable it deal adequately deal with emerging crimes and recmmended prsecutins that are likely t arise frm the TJRC Prcess 7
